verifiable

ve·ri·fiable

UK/vɛɹ.ɪˈfaɪ.ə.bəl/ US/ˈvɛɹ.ɪ.faɪ.ə.bəl/ uncommon

adjective

1.

capable of being verified

  • “a verifiable account of the incident”

2.

capable of being tested (verified or falsified) by experiment or observation

Origin

From verify + -able.
